Notice of intention to commence Local Plan preparation
View our notice of intention to commence Local Plan preparation.
North Norfolk District Council, as the Local Planning Authority for North Norfolk, gives notice of its intention to commence Local Plan preparation. This notice is prepared and published in accordance with the requirements of the Town and Country Planning (Local Planning) (England) Regulations 2026 (Regulation 19).
Title of the Local Plan
The new plan will be called the 'North Norfolk Local Plan 2029 to 2045'. The Local Plan will not cover minerals and waste as Norfolk County Council is the planning authority for these matters.
Geographical area the plan will cover
The Plan will cover the administrative area of North Norfolk District Council, ONS E07000147, but does not include the Broads Authority Executive Area.
Where the Local Plan timetable can be viewed
The published timetable can be found on our Local Plan timetable webpage. It is also available for inspection during normal office hours at the Council's office: Holt Road, Cromer, NR27 9EN. Please contact us in advance if you wish to view this.
The Council expects to pass through Gateway 1 and formally begin the 30-month plan preparation process by 31 October 2026.
This notice will remain available for public inspection for the duration of the Local Plan preparation and for at least 3 months following its adoption.
